Leeds v CheltenhamSimon Grayson is keeping his squad on their toes ahead of tomorrow’s game with Cheltenham, a match that Leeds have to win to get our play-off campaign back on track. He told the official site "Changes are a possibility. Players who have been around the squad may have a chance to come into the fold and prove that they are there to stay until the end of the season, because the performance on Tuesday at Hereford wasn't acceptable. Players will be looking over the shoulders and those that are in there have to prove they are capable of staying there.”
Jonathan Douglas back from suspension, but Jermaine Beckford is still banned for one more game. So it’s fortunate that Becchio is eligible to play before he has to serve a one match ban of his own against Scunthorpe next week, especially as Liam Dickinson won’t be joining us on loan as he’s now picked up an injury. Grayson has hinted that Dickinson may yet come to Elland Road at some point in the future, if and when he regains his fitness, but also said that he is now looking elsewhere for possible loan signings.
And we’ve still got to get somebody to fill in at right back, with Richardson and Hughes both still struggling for fitness. According to Simon Grayson, "Both injuries are coming along nicely, although whether the weekend comes too soon we'll have to see." Carl Dickinson played at right back on Tuesday, but he has returned to Stoke as his loan spell has finished, so maybe Douglas will have to take his turn in that position.
